i have a white bro's exhaust and uni dual stage air filter. i live in upstate NY where i have been riding in 30-40 degree days BRRRRR but fun. i run a 60 main jet and i moved the clip on the needle down 1 which is 2 up from the bottom. it raised the needle and it does run rich at idle to 1/4 turn but from 1/4 to fulll throttle its a lil bit rich but there is NO bog and it takes right off i have excellent low end power, my middle range is great and high it dies off but thats just because the the engine is stock. i'd rather it run a bit on the rich side than lean. no need to pop an engine even though i know the fiddy motor can take it. my air/fuel screw is about 3/4 turn out and idle screw is about 3 1/2 turns out. this is the 1st carb i have ever worked on. its a pain in the A s s ive spent about 15+ hours ripping it apart and putting it back together and riding it to see if i accomplished anything. learn how to do a plug chop and that will help you determine what you need to do.

bro, im not trying to punk anyone. im trying to help you. you are thinking backwards trust me. i work on fiddys every single day and have been building small engines in general for 14 years.
adding an aftermarket exhaust and/or filter will indeed let more air in and out of the engine. a stock carb cannot keep up to these demands, there for a larger jet is needed to accomodate that extra air that is entering the engine.
too much air = lean condition
too much fuel = rich condition
